Does White Castle use real onions?

It is a ridiculous myth. The company admits in their FAQ that they use dehydrated onions for their burgers, as they have been doing since World War II, when onions were rationed and in short supply.

How much was a White Castle burger in 1921?

White Castle opened its first restaurant in Wichita, Kansas, in 1921 and sold its burgers for only 5 cents. During the 1930s prices increased slowly. It was 1950 before the price of a hamburger rose from 10 to 12 cents. The 12-cent price held until 1967 when the price of a burger increased to 14 cents.

Why is it called White Castle?

Drawing inspiration from the castle-like look of the water pumping station in downtown Chicago, the two men decided to call the new restaurant “White Castle” and make the building look like a small white castle. Porcelain was used on the interior to emphasize a sparkling clean all-white restaurant.

Why are there 5 holes in White Castle burgers?

The crave-worthy sliders have five holes in the patties. According to CBS News, this is so the burger can be thoroughly cooked through faster without having to flip it over. The idea to incorporate these holes came from an employee suggestion back in 1954.

What came first mcdonalds or White Castle?

White Castle predates McDonald's by 19 years, the burger giant being founded in 1940. It also predates Burger King, or Insta-Burger King, as it used to be called, as well as KFC, Sonic, and Whataburger, all of which opened up during the fast food boom in the 1950s.
